Led by one of the project team, this cycling tour takes you through the woodlands at Ickworth to the Monument.

At 95 feet (29 meters) tall, this limestone gift to the Earl Bishop is the highest point on the estate and the second highest in Suffolk. Lord Bristol's Monument has a heart felt inscription at the base in memory of the Earl Bishop, and was erected in 1817.

The project that inspired this event aims to research, protect, and restore areas of the monument that may become safe over time.
